南昌达内IT培训学校
4000857126
新闻详情

南昌靠谱的大数据开发培训机构名单榜首公布

来源:南昌达内IT培训学校时间:2023/3/20 10:51:20 浏览量:61

  达内IT培训-达内26*大课程体系紧跟企业需求,技术讲师团汇聚,实战经验倾囊相授,达内软件开发培训班采用因材施教,分级辅导的模式,根据不同学员开设就业班,辅导班,才高班,灵活多样的班型,满足不同人群的需求,让学员学到真本领!

  大数据全栈工程师,小白也能拿高薪!来达内&大数据培训机构学习大数据,带给你的不只是高薪,更是技术的提升.达内大数据培训班让每位学员都能找到适合自己的课程,练就更牛技术,挑战更高薪水,学大数据就到达内&大数据培训机构。

  课程直切企业需求 培养数据分析人才

  数据库编程

  数据分析基础编程;数据分析宏语言;数据分析SQL;数据分析编程

  统计分析

  多元统计:因子分析,聚类分析;统计基础与假设检验,T检验与方差分析;线性回归与模型修正,逻辑回归;统计基础与实践序列

  数据挖掘

  数据挖掘前期处理与决策树;逻辑回归与神经网络;聚类模型、关联分类;常见数据挖掘工具要点分析

  Python爬虫

  Python的基本语法;基于Python的爬虫实现;Scrapy、PySpider等爬虫框架;利用Python爬虫获取数据

  数据可视化

  利用Echars等Web前端技术;利用相关数据可视化工具;数据可视化解决方案分享;业务评估系统BI设计与实现

  数据分析+Hadoop

  Hadoop平台使用;其他分析工具与大数据应用讲解;数据分析数据库管理平台接口课程

  大数据开发:SpringBoot架构详解

  一.SpringBoot简介

  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。通过这种方式,Spring Boot致力于在蓬勃发展的应用开发领域(rapid application development)成为。

  我们在使用Spring Boot时只需要配置相应的Spring Boot就可以用所有的Spring组件,简单的说,spring boot就是整合了很多的框架,不用我们自己手动的去写一堆xml配置然后进行配置。从本质上来说,Spring Boot就是Spring,它做了那些没有它你也会去做的Spring Bean配置。

  二.为什么要使用SpringBoot

  Spring的组件代码轻量,配置却是重量级

  Spring是Java企业版(Java Enterprise Edition,JEE,也称J2EE)的轻量级代替品。无需开发重量级的Enterprise JavaBean(EJB),Spring为企业级Java开发提供了一种相对简单的方法,通过控制反转IOC和面向切面编程AOP,用简单的Java对象(Plain Old Java Object,POJO)实现了EJB的功能。

  但是用过Spring的都知道,配置过程较为复杂,每个Bean的装配都要在xml中配置一下才能自动装入。

  当只有少量Bean时,配置过程还不怎么复杂,但是SSM框架整合,还有些其它框架加入,配置过程就变得比较复杂。

  Spring 2.5引入了基于注解的组件扫描,这消除了大量针对应用程序自身组件的显式XML配置。Spring 3.0引入了基于Java的配置,这是一种类型安全的可重构配置方式,可以代替XML。

  但是每个项目都需要进行这个繁琐但又必须的配置过程,因此急需一个工具来自动处理Spring配置过程。这就是Pivotal团队设计SpringBoot的初衷。

  Spring的优点也是SpringBoot的优点,SpringBoot还解决了Spring的缺点

  SpringBoot对上述Spring的缺点进行的改善和优化,基于 约定优于配置 的思想,可以让开发人员不必在配置与逻辑业务之间进行思维的切换,全身心的投入到逻辑业务的代码编写中,从而大大提高了开发的效率,一定程度上缩短了项目周期。

  三.SpringBoot的优缺点

  SpringBoot的优点:

  (1)创建独立运行的Spring项目以及与主流框架集成

  (2)使用嵌入式的Servlet容器,应用无需打成WAR包跑在servlet容器上。打成Jar包,然后java -jar即可运行

  (3)starters自动依赖与版本控制

  (4)大量的自动配置,简化开发,也可以修改默认值

  (5)无需配置XML,无代码生成,开箱即用

  (6)准生产环境的运行时应用监控

  (7)与云计算的天然集成

  SpringBoot的缺点:

  入门容易,精通难。之所以那么说,是因为SpringBoot是基于SpringBoot的一个再封装,如果你对Spring框架一无所知,那就做不到精通。

  四.SpringBoot特点

  (1)创立独立的Spring应用程序

  (2)嵌入的Tomcat,无需部署war文件

  (3)简化Maven配置

  (4)自动配置Spring

  (5)提供生产就绪功能,如指标,健康检查和外部配置

  (6)没有代码生成和对XML没有配置要求

  五、SpringBoot核心功能

  ①、起步依赖

  SpringBoot起步依赖就是前面那篇创建springBoot项目中,手动创建法时,在项目Maven核心配置文件pom.xml中添加的spring-boot-starter-parent

  这是一个Maven项目对象模型(Project Object Model,POM),定义了对其他库的传递依赖,这些东西加在一起即支持某项功能。

  简单的说,起步依赖就是将具备Spring功能(还包括其它功能)的坐标打包到一起,并提供一些默认的功能。

  ②、自动配置

  Spring Boot的自动配置是一个运行时(更准确地说,是应用程序启动时)的过程,考虑了众多因素,才决定Spring配置应该用哪个,不该用哪个。该过程是Spring Boot自动完成的。

  比如前面博客演示的手动创建SpringBoot项目,没有编写任何Spring、SpringMVC框架相关的配置,该项目通过SpringBoot就完成了Spring、SpringMVC的整合。

  以上就是SpringBoot框架概述的有关解析,这些知识内容对于SpringBoot入门已经足够了!

尊重原创文章,转载请注明出处与链接:http://www.soxsok.com/wnews770380.html 违者必究! 以上就是关于“南昌靠谱的大数据开发培训机构名单榜首公布”的全部内容了,想了解更多相关知识请持续关注本站。

温馨提示:为不影响您的学业,来 南昌大数据培训 校区前请先电话或QQ咨询,方便我校安排相关的专业老师为您解答
教学环境
  • 达内环境

    达内环境

  • 达内环境

    达内环境

  • 达内环境

    达内环境

预约申请
  • * 您的姓名
  • * 联系电话
  • * 报名课程
  •   备注说明
提交报名
版权所有:搜学搜课(www.soxsok.com) 技术支持:搜学搜课网